Sporty car

The design of the car is sporty, but the engine size (4 cylinder same as the Mazda 3) could be upped to a six cylinder. Acceleration is adequate with the six speed manual transmission. 19" "performance" tires look good, but are unusable in the snow. Need to purchase a set of all season tires if you live where snow is possible. Recommend Mazda trade the performance tires for all-seasons as standard. Don't particularly need a tire rated at 140 mph ! Better gas mileage than advertised if you stay under 75. Overall nice car, at a fair price.
